Be Safe and Secure: Security Features on Your Smartwatch

by Tiffany YI on March 06, 2023

 

Smartwatches have become an essential gadget for many people around the world. Not only do they tell time, but they also offer various functionalities like messaging, music streaming, fitness tracking, and many more. However, like any other electronic device, smartwatches are also vulnerable to cyber-attacks, data breaches, and theft. Therefore, it's crucial to ensure that your smartwatch has adequate security features to keep your data and personal information safe. Here are some security features to look for in your smartwatch:

 

PIN Code and Password Protection

Just like your smartphone or tablet, your smartwatch should have a password or PIN code to secure your device. This feature prevents unauthorized access to your smartwatch and keeps your data safe. Always ensure that you set a unique and secure password that you can easily remember, but difficult for others to guess. Additionally, you should avoid sharing your password with anyone or writing it down.

 
Two-Factor Authentication

Two-factor authentication (2FA) is an additional layer of security that requires a user to provide two different forms of identification to access their account or device. This feature helps to prevent unauthorized access, even if someone knows your password. For instance, some smartwatches use biometric authentication like facial recognition technology to ensure that only the authorized user can access the device.

 

Encryption

Encryption is a process of converting your data into a code that's difficult for unauthorized persons to access or read. This feature is essential, especially when sending sensitive information like banking details or personal identification numbers. With encryption, your data is secure and safe from hackers and cybercriminals who might try to steal your information.

 

Remote Wiping and Locking

Remote wiping and locking features allow you to erase all data on your smartwatch in case it gets lost or stolen. This feature ensures that your personal data doesn't fall into the wrong hands. Additionally, it's advisable to ensure that your smartwatch has the 'Find my Device' feature, which helps you locate your device if you lose it.

 

App Permissions

Smartwatches use various apps that access your personal information, including contacts, location, and health data. Therefore, it's essential to check the app permissions to ensure that you're comfortable with the data the app can access. Avoid giving permissions to apps that you don't trust, as they might expose your personal information to cybercriminals.

 

Software Updates

Smartwatch manufacturers regularly release software updates that include bug fixes, security patches, and new features. These updates are essential to keep your device secure and protect it from new and emerging threats. Ensure that you regularly update your smartwatch software to keep it up to date with the latest security features.

 

GPS Tracking

GPS tracking is a useful feature that enables you to track your smartwatch's location in real-time. This feature is beneficial, especially when you're traveling, jogging, or doing any outdoor activities. Additionally, some smartwatches have a geofencing feature that alerts you when your device goes beyond a particular location.

 

In conclusion, smartwatches offer convenience and numerous functionalities that make our lives easier. However, they also present various security risks that can compromise your personal information and data. Therefore, it's crucial to ensure that your smartwatch has adequate security features to keep your data safe from cybercriminals and hackers. Ensure that you enable all the security features available on your smartwatch, including PIN code, encryption, two-factor authentication, app permissions, software updates, and GPS tracking. With these security features, you can enjoy using your smartwatch with peace of mind.
